PTT推薦

[閒聊] Solidity vs Move

看板DigiCurrency標題[閒聊] Solidity vs Move作者
ccs93313
(阿文)
時間推噓 6 推:6 噓:0 →:19

本人非開發者也沒有太深的程式背景,蠻好奇版內大大們有沒有親自使用 Solidity 和 Move 語言的經驗,對於這兩種語言有以下疑問:

1. Solidity 應該是現在主流的語言?但不好使用?

2. Move 則是開發者友善? 比較容易無痛學習?

謝謝各位大大解惑!


--

※ PTT 留言評論
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 111.71.78.41 (臺灣)
PTT 網址

DarkerDuck06/15 22:54你要在哪個區塊鏈上寫程式?Move主要在Aptos和Sui上

DarkerDuck06/15 22:55對於本科生來說,Solidity使用上並沒有什麼困難

DarkerDuck06/15 22:58理解智能合約上對於變數上的限制,有些Python的基礎

DarkerDuck06/15 22:58那要開始寫一個solidity智能合約學習曲線並不陡峭

DarkerDuck06/15 22:59當然要搞到完全沒bug可以通過審計就另外一回事

DarkerDuck06/15 23:01Solidity的開發生態也很完整,甚至瀏覽器就可搞定

DarkerDuck06/15 23:02對於本科生來說,Javascript和Python與C++都會碰過

DarkerDuck06/15 23:02配合一下remix網頁編譯器,一天內就可以寫出合約

DarkerDuck06/15 23:06不過你假如完全沒有程式與相關背景的話

DarkerDuck06/15 23:07那可能感受就不一樣

ripple012906/15 23:57看了一下move的tutorial也沒多友善,我看還是資源多

ripple012906/15 23:57的solidity遇到問題比較容易找到答案吧

ripple012906/16 00:00你其實直接叫ChatGPT各寫一段發幣的合約比較一下看兩

ripple012906/16 00:00邊哪個語法比較適合你,這樣比較快。

staytuned7406/16 00:02solidity ChatGPT應該會稍微可靠 ,冷門程式你就要

staytuned7406/16 00:02常常debug ChatGPT

pinner06/16 00:15solidity連lambda function都有支援 去年知道這件事覺得

pinner06/16 00:15兩年的開發經驗都是假的 後來就再也不寫了QQ

ripple012906/16 01:54語法糖不用也沒差吧,幹嘛糾結XD

JapaZPa486706/16 03:58建議先學 golang 再練 solidity

JapaZPa486706/16 03:58基本上 主流鏈的開發 都能應付了

JapaZPa486706/16 03:59Move 和 Rust 生態還不是特別成熟

JapaZPa486706/16 03:59想投入生產環境 估計要多費很多時間

jugu06/16 07:01一兩年甚至三五年內,Move並不比Solidity更優越

ccs9331306/16 08:37感謝大大們解惑 ♂ ♂